lokigi means 'to locate' or 'to place' in the Esperanto language.

(or it's the backronym 'Location Optimisation: K-best solution Inspection, Generation & Insights' - whichever floats your boat)

lokigi exists to make the process of providing decision support for healthcare problems with a geographical component easier.

A range of fantastic libraries exist for geographic optimization (e.g. spopt), but many use linear programming to optimize the solution, meaning you emerge with a single optimal solution. For healthcare contexts, this often isn't ideal - decision makers need a range of near-optimal solutions to balance against real-world constraints.

Building on work from Dr Tom Monks and previous rounds of the Health Service Modelling Associates programme, lokigi is designed to make it easier to beginner programmers to tackle location optimization problems for the benefit of their organisations.

Lokigi is planned to expand to boundary optimisation problems in the future.
